
Senua's Saga: Hellblade 2 age rating teases imminent news drop
Nov 30, 2023 4:31 PMGaming fans are anticipating potential news for Senua's Saga: Hellblade 2 following a new 18+ age rating from Australia, sparking speculation about a nearing release date or additional reveals. There's buzz that a new trailer might be showcased at The Game Awards, which will be broadcasted on the night of December 7 to December 8. Hellblade 2, the sequel to the acclaimed Hellblade: Senua's Sacrifice, focuses on protagonist Senua's trials in a violent world while dealing with psychosis. Developed by Ninja Theory, now part of Xbox Game Studios, the title is set to launch on Xbox Series X|S and PC in 2024. Fans are eager for more details about the highly-anticipated game, possibly arriving during The Game Awards.
